Brentford enjoy home advantage, when visitors Manchester City swing by on Sunday for a clash in the Premier League. The former will be looking to make that home advantage count.
Placed 13th in the table Brentford have amassed seven points after six matches. On ten points, Manchester City rank seventh with six matches played this season.
Team form: Brentford vs Manchester City
Brentford Form
Brentford delivered a bit of everything as their last three matches resulted in a win, a loss and a draw. An encounter with Aston Villa brought a 1-1 draw, which was followed by a 3-1 defeat at the hands of Fulham. Their most recent game had them back on the winning trail, as they beat Manchester United by 3-1. Brentford won four of their last six Premier League matches on home soil, while drawing once and losing once. They conceded 11 and scored 16 goals.
Manchester City Form
Manchester City look well suited to take on any opponent presently, as their last three matches saw them gaining two victories and a draw. They ran out 0-2 and 5-1 winners against Huddersfield and Burnley, respectively. Their winning streak came to an end against Monaco, as the match resulted in a 2-2 draw. Manchester City managed a decent return of three wins in their last six Premier League away matches, in which they scored ten while also conceding three times. They also experienced two draws and one defeat.
